| static int load_prog(const struct bpf_insn *insns, |
| enum bpf_attach_type expected_attach_type) |
| { |
| LIBBPF_OPTS(bpf_prog_load_opts, opts, |
| .expected_attach_type = expected_attach_type, |
| .log_level = 2, |
| .log_buf = bpf_log_buf, |
| .log_size = sizeof(bpf_log_buf), |
| ); |
| int fd, insns_cnt = 0; |
| |
| for (; |
| insns[insns_cnt].code != (BPF_JMP | BPF_EXIT); |
| insns_cnt++) { |
| } |
| insns_cnt++; |
| |
| fd = bpf_prog_load(BPF_PROG_TYPE_CGROUP_SOCK, NULL, "GPL", insns, |
| insns_cnt, &opts); |
| if (fd < 0) |
| fprintf(stderr, "%s\n", bpf_log_buf); |
| |
| return fd; |
| } |
| |
| static int bind_sock(int domain, int type, const char *ip, |
| unsigned short port, unsigned short port_retry) |
| { |
| struct sockaddr_storage addr; |
| struct sockaddr_in6 *addr6; |
| struct sockaddr_in *addr4; |
| int sockfd = -1; |
| socklen_t len; |
| int res = SUCCESS; |
| |
| sockfd = socket(domain, type, 0); |
| if (sockfd < 0) |
| goto err; |
| |
| memset(&addr, 0, sizeof(addr)); |
| |
| if (domain == AF_INET) { |
| len = sizeof(struct sockaddr_in); |
| addr4 = (struct sockaddr_in *)&addr; |
| addr4->sin_family = domain; |
| addr4->sin_port = htons(port); |
| if (inet_pton(domain, ip, (void *)&addr4->sin_addr) != 1) |
| goto err; |
| } else if (domain == AF_INET6) { |
| len = sizeof(struct sockaddr_in6); |
| addr6 = (struct sockaddr_in6 *)&addr; |
| addr6->sin6_family = domain; |
| addr6->sin6_port = htons(port); |
| if (inet_pton(domain, ip, (void *)&addr6->sin6_addr) != 1) |
| goto err; |
| } else { |
| goto err; |
| } |
| |
| if (bind(sockfd, (const struct sockaddr *)&addr, len) == -1) { |
| /* sys_bind() may fail for different reasons, errno has to be |
| * checked to confirm that BPF program rejected it. |
| */ |
| if (errno != EPERM) |
| goto err; |
| if (port_retry) |
| goto retry; |
| res = BIND_REJECT; |
| goto out; |
| } |
| |
| goto out; |
| retry: |
| if (domain == AF_INET) |
| addr4->sin_port = htons(port_retry); |
| else |
| addr6->sin6_port = htons(port_retry); |
| if (bind(sockfd, (const struct sockaddr *)&addr, len) == -1) { |
| if (errno != EPERM) |
| goto err; |
| res = RETRY_REJECT; |
| } else { |
| res = RETRY_SUCCESS; |
| } |
| goto out; |
| err: |
| res = -1; |
| out: |
| close(sockfd); |
| return res; |
| } |
| |
| static int run_test(int cgroup_fd, struct sock_post_bind_test *test) |
| { |
| int err, prog_fd, res, ret = 0; |
| |
| prog_fd = load_prog(test->insns, test->expected_attach_type); |
| if (prog_fd < 0) |
| goto err; |
| |
| err = bpf_prog_attach(prog_fd, cgroup_fd, test->attach_type, 0); |
| if (err < 0) { |
| if (test->result == ATTACH_REJECT) |
| goto out; |
| else |
| goto err; |
| } |
| |
| res = bind_sock(test->domain, test->type, test->ip, test->port, |
| test->port_retry); |
| if (res > 0 && test->result == res) |
| goto out; |
| err: |
| ret = -1; |
| out: |
| /* Detaching w/o checking return code: best effort attempt. */ |
| if (prog_fd != -1) |
| bpf_prog_detach(cgroup_fd, test->attach_type); |
| close(prog_fd); |
| return ret; |
| } |
